Geschichte der
B-17 41-24442 / Little Eva
Assigned 326BS/92BG Bangor 31/7/42; 342BS/97BG Polebrook 8/42; Maison Blanche 13/11/42; Tafaraoui 22/11/42; bombed and damaged on base by Luftwaffe 23/12/42; Salvaged. LITTLE EVA.

My father, Alex Blair, in his diary wrote on 12/26/1942 that a „Ju88 dive-bombed „Little Eva“ on the ground“. He was a pilot and mentions flying Little Eva as he states he always wanted a plane named „Little Eva“.
